Firfield Primary School - Eco Greenhouse |
|
Church Wilne Rotary recently supplied & built their fourth ECO Greenhouse, this time at Firfield Primary School in Breaston. The cost of the materials was kindly donated by Evans Pharmacy of Breaston, Breaston Parish Council and Breaston Co-op. The idea for the Eco greenhouse was presented to Year 6 teacher Carol Lawson by her pupil Evie Broderick, granddaughter of Rotarian Susie Collins who leads this ongoing project. Carol Lawson went on to say; The Eco Greenhouse project helps awareness of environmental issues and will bring the children closer to nature with an opportunity to see crops grow. The school was also presented with a £250 Collyer's Nursery voucher to help them with their horticultural journey. |
